Title:
PHOTOCATALYST-CARRYING FIBROUS ACTIVATED CHARCOAL AND ITS PRODUCTION METHOD

Abstract:

To provide a photocatalyst-carrying fibrous activated charcoal also having adsorption ability and decomposition ability of an adsorbed substance, in which the photocatalyst is not easily peeled off from the fibrous activated charcoal, i.e., a carrier even under environment of a large amount of moisture content.

The photocatalyst-carrying fibrous activated charcoal is the fibrous activated charcoal carried with rutile type titanium oxide and is characterized in that the rutile type titanium oxide is not peeled off and dropped off even after the fibrous activated charcoal is immersed in water of 25°C for one hour. In the production method for the photocatalyst-carrying fibrous activated charcoal, the fibrous activated charcoal is immersed in water in which anatase type titanium oxide and amorphous type peroxotitanic acid are mixed and the anatase type titanium oxide and the amorphous type peroxotitanic acid are imparted to the fibrous activated charcoal and dried, thereafter, it is calcined at the temperature from 800°C to 1,500°C under vacuum and the anatase type titanium oxide is converted to the rutile type titanium oxide.
